开学以来,张毅从来没上过一节课,高自考和普通全日制本科不太一样,每次上课时,基本都是几个班合在一起上。
大的阶梯教室,几百个人在一起上课,上课老师根本没时间点名查考勤,是否愿意去上课,全靠学生自觉了。
第一节课,是高数,这个他曾经最恐惧的学科。老师是个胖胖的中年大叔,笑呵呵的,弥勒佛一般,非常有亲和力。
内容是函数,非常烦琐,又有难度的内容,前世时,张毅上高数课时,就像听天书,本身数学底子就差,又没兴趣,所以越来越差,越差就越不愿意学,形成了恶性循环。
现在的他呢?听起数学课,觉得很愉悦,甚至超过他对计算机编程的快乐感。看着数字在眼前,随着自己的心意,被随意排列,随意简化而直达核心,那种满足感无与伦比。何况,易扩展、易维护的函数式编程是未来模块化编程一个方向。
软件编程方面成就的高低,其实除了扎实的编程基础外,最重要的就是高数水平,软件编程就像个系统工程,灵魂是算法,而算法最能体现数学的水平。能给你达到目标最简洁的办法。
重生以来,张毅编程的技术突飞猛进,但现在的数学水平怎么样,他没有一个直观的印像,也就是说不知道自己的数学水平到底到什么地步了。所以,故意选择一节高数课,来做一下对比。
老师讲的很简单,他感觉,自己如果上台去讲,可能比老师讲得还要透彻,一道例题,他心里掠过不下10种解题方法。
放弃了听课,他直接快速的翻起了课本。
第一章:函数与极限,没什么难度。第二章:常量与变量,和c语言的变量无多大区别。
张毅翻书的速度越来越快,一页页的内容在他眼前快速掠过,旁边的李小明看着这一切,不知道他在搞什么:练翻书速度吗?
挺厚的书,张毅很快翻完,摇摇头,放下书,叹了一口气:脑海中的这块智能硬盘实在太可怕了,以前对他说,难如登天的高数,在现在的他看来,实在是小菜一碟。
在接近下课的时候,胖胖的数学老师在黑板上留下一道题,题目的内容是一道函数求极限值方法的问题,老师直言:如果能解开这道题,会拥有一些特权。
有几个同学好奇的问是什么特权,数学老师并没有明言。
张毅想起来,前世记忆里,好像是有这么一档子事,说是一个年级,三个班100多名学生,只有一名学生,用了一个星期的时间,想到了解题方法,后来这个学生,去代表学校参加什么竞赛。
再后来,这个学生就没有消息了。似乎听说跟着一位有名的数学大牛,搞什么模型去了。
仔细想了想,他现在经常不在学校,的确需要一些特权,否则,被老师抓住小辫子,也是一件烦人的事。
于是,他举起手,胖老师看到了,示意他上讲台。
来到讲台上,拿起一只粉笔,正要在黑板上解题。胖老师阻止了他,看看他胸有成竹的样子,好奇的递给他一只钢笔。
他不假思索的,随手在稿纸上寥寥写了几行解题过程,又画了个示意图,然后把钢笔递给胖老师。
惊讶的抓起稿纸,胖老师心里在嘀咕:这么几行解题过程,不可能的。
解题步骤简单到令人发指,胖老师看不懂解题过程,但是答案却是对的。
他抑制住震惊,仔细看了看旁边的图示,结合解题步骤,马上明白了解题的思路。
这道题在后世的21世纪,很多的算法书上都提到过的,是数学模型应用到计算机一个具体的案例。
张毅对这道题熟悉无比,再加上他现在对数学的精通程度,即使抛开前世的记忆,现在的他,也能拿出最少五种